What is a Parent College Student Contract Form and Its Benefits?

Definition & Meaning

A parent college student contract form is a formal agreement between parents and their college-aged children. This document outlines the expectations, responsibilities, and financial commitments of both parties during the student's college years. It typically covers various aspects such as academic performance, financial support, communication standards, and behavioral expectations. By establishing clear guidelines, this contract aims to foster mutual understanding and accountability, helping to prevent misunderstandings and conflicts.

For example, the contract may specify that the student must maintain a minimum GPA, attend all classes, and communicate regularly with their parents about academic progress. In return, parents might agree to cover tuition fees, provide living expenses, and support the student emotionally throughout their college journey.

How to fill out Parent College Student Contract Template

Filling out a parent college student contract template requires careful attention to detail. Start by entering the student's full name and the name of the college they will attend. Next, outline specific academic expectations, such as maintaining a certain GPA or attending a minimum number of classes each semester.

Following the academic section, detail the financial commitments, including tuition fees, living expenses, and any additional costs like textbooks or supplies. It is also crucial to include a section on communication, specifying how often the student should update their parents on their progress.

Lastly, both parties should review the completed contract together to ensure mutual understanding and agreement before signing. This collaborative approach fosters a sense of partnership and accountability.

Key elements of the Parent College Student Contract Template

Several key elements should be included in a parent college student contract template to ensure comprehensive coverage of responsibilities and expectations. These elements typically include:

  • Academic Expectations: Specify required GPA, class attendance, and participation in academic activities.
  • Financial Responsibilities: Detail who will cover tuition, living expenses, and other financial commitments.
  • Communication Guidelines: Establish how often the student should communicate with their parents and the preferred methods of communication.
  • Behavioral Expectations: Outline acceptable behavior and conduct, including any consequences for violations.
  • Duration of Agreement: State the time frame for the contract, typically covering the entire college duration.

Including these elements ensures that both parents and students have a clear understanding of their roles, promoting a healthy and supportive college experience.

Examples of using the Parent College Student Contract Template

Real-world examples of using a parent college student contract template can illustrate its effectiveness. For instance, a family might create a contract that specifies the student must maintain a GPA of 3.0 or higher to receive financial support for tuition. If the student fails to meet this requirement, the contract may outline a plan for re-evaluation of support.

Another example could involve a student agreeing to check in with their parents bi-weekly to discuss academic progress and any challenges faced. This regular communication can help parents provide timely support and guidance, reinforcing the partnership established in the contract.

These examples highlight how a well-structured contract can facilitate open dialogue and set clear expectations, ultimately contributing to the student's success.

Legal use of the Parent College Student Contract Template

The legal use of a parent college student contract template is important for ensuring that both parties understand their rights and obligations. While this contract is not typically legally binding in the same way as a lease or employment agreement, it can still hold significant weight in family discussions and expectations.

To enhance its legal standing, both parties should sign and date the contract, indicating their agreement to the terms. It may also be beneficial to have the contract notarized, adding an extra layer of formality and authenticity. However, it is essential to remember that the enforceability of such contracts can vary by state, so consulting a legal professional for advice may be prudent.
